Output 1504ef51bd60c95122ee5e12283895c21919e1056811072592ddb9e971d7610f:0

value
629429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d98052f368a4ba6582462301a47cbd4958a1dfc OP_EQUALVERIFY OP_CHECKSIG
address
1Kk5dsttvdAmDykeCzWbQk6GbJ8Bcpk8F7
transaction
1504ef51bd60c95122ee5e12283895c21919e1056811072592ddb9e971d7610f
confirmations
453771
spent
true